Default SH5 and inspiration

Yesterday I broke down to temptation and for the first time in years I used "silentotto" to see what lies ahead. I say years as I started off with a hand-me-down SH5 Ver 1.0 that only worked as a vanilla stand-alone. I must have started that first "get out of bed Captain" section 50 times as I came to understand what to do. I had not yet found the SubSim forums so it was all hit and miss, mostly miss. But the concept of how the SH5 program worked, the graphics and what it offered kept drawing me back to the simulation.

Much, much later I found this forum and lurked about for a long while, only to find that there were earlier SH3 and SH4 versions that I was unaware of. By this time I found out that Steam now sold SH5 and I added it to my wish list. Well as much as I wished, I could never get a break and be on-line at the same time that SH5 was discounted. Finally my son, having seen me through the years fighting with frozen screens and CTD's finally put me out my misery and gifted me a surprise Christmas present - a Steam version of SH5. This gift now runs exceptionally well as a Steam installation and the WoS megamod for me was a must have.

So that is history, but what of the future? Yesterday I was given a glimpse into the "Distant Waters" campaign. What an exciting graphical and location change from my many starts, re-starts in the "Coastal Waters" campaign. By the end of the day I was given new hope, to take each session as a step towards the "Happy Times" campaign and the new experiences still ahead that SH5 has to offer. I have written this as an inspiration to other members who like myself never thought it was possible to ever get out of the starting "Coastal Waters" campaign. I have only just had a glimpse into what lies ahead, and now I have all the inspiration I need, to make it to the end of the war.
